How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bethlehem?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bethlehem Studio Apartments | $1,602 | $1,235 | $2,590 |
| Bethlehem 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,714 | $1,100 | $2,395 |
| Bethlehem 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,052 | $1,400 | $3,490 |
| Bethlehem 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,280 | $1,425 | $3,239 |
| Bethlehem 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,496 | $2,300 | $2,692 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Bethlehem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Bethlehem with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Bethlehem is at Polk on Third listed at $1,425.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Bethlehem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Bethlehem is $2,052.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Bethlehem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Bethlehem is a 1,310 square feet unit starting from $2,335 at Woodmont Mews.
What is the average size for Bethlehem 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Bethlehem is currently 1,245 sq ft.
